  4. American Optometric Association -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/American_Optometric...

    Optometrists serve patients in nearly 6,500 communities across the country, and in 3,500 of those communities are the only eye doctors. Doctors of optometry provide two-thirds of all primary eye care in the United States. Founded in 1898, the AOA is a federation of state, student and armed forces optometric associations.

  5. American Academy of Ophthalmology -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/American_Academy_of...

    The American Academy of Ophthalmology is a professional medical association of ophthalmologists. It is headquartered in San Francisco, California . Its membership of 32,000 medical doctors includes more than 90 percent of practicing ophthalmologists in the United States as well as over 7,000 members abroad.

  8. Anterior segment mesenchymal dysgenesis -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Anterior_segment...

    Peters' (frequently misspelled as Peter's) anomaly is a specific type of mesenchymal anterior segment dysgenesis, in which there is central corneal leukoma, adhesions of the iris and cornea and abnormalities of the posterior corneal stroma, Descemet's membrane, corneal endothelium, lens and anterior chamber.
